Interviewer-"First of all can you tell me the story of like that sort of changing at UT Arlington and what kind of, who did you have to organize with?" Mr. Medrano-Well the same students that we all ended up commuting in one car, so there was not commuting in one car [?] we all commuting in one car, so there is no transportation [?]. The campus was small, so we commuted back and forth, back and forth and since we are already knew what it was to approach, you know, a president or principal or [?] were kind of, no fear, no fear, you know. What we wanted is what we wanted. And, so, at that time then, we ended up meeting other activists that are there from different areas-Fort Worth, you know, different suburbias. Interviewer-"Which groups were they, were they a certain groups or?" Mr. Medrano-Well, the Black Panthers were already, well there was already a couple of African Americans, The [?] were there, its a very activist wide militant activitst [?] was there already, so there a lot of [?] weather. Intervierwer-"Underground?" Mr. Medrano-weather man. Interviewer-"Weather underground, am I right?" Interviewer-Weather man and the weather underground."Interviewer-"OK" Mr. Medrano-We met them and the war was on [?] escalation of Kennedy in 63 advisors, so that makes me that makes me three years into the campus, 63 in activism and [?] they are killing out brothers and sisters, 18 year olds are the ones that are being drafted, cause I was draft at that time...
